We are looking for reliable and hardworking Construction Labourer to join a busy site. This is a great opportunity for someone who enjoys hands-on work, thrives in a site environment, and is looking for steady and long-term opportunities.
Key Responsibilities:
- Assisting trades and site management
- Keeping the site clean, safe, and organised
- Moving materials and equipment
- Performing general labouring duties as required
- Following all health & safety procedures
Requirements:
- Valid CSCS card
- Previous site experience preferred
- Punctual, hardworking, and a good team player
- PPE (boots, hard hat, hi-vis)
What We Offer:
- Weekly pay
- Ongoing work for reliable workers

How to prepare for a job interview at GM Recruitment
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, brush up on your knowledge of construction practices and health & safety procedures. Familiarise yourself with the tools and materials commonly used on site, as this will show that you're serious about the role and ready to hit the ground running.
✨Dress for Success
Make sure to wear appropriate attire for the interview. While it’s not a construction site, showing up in smart casual clothing is a good idea. If you have your PPE gear, bring it along to demonstrate your commitment to safety and readiness for the job.
✨Be Punctual
Arriving on time is crucial, especially in the construction industry where reliability is key. Plan your route in advance and aim to arrive a little early. This will give you a chance to relax and gather your thoughts before the interview starts.
✨Show Your Team Spirit
Construction work is all about teamwork, so be prepared to discuss your experience working with others. Share examples of how you've collaborated with colleagues or assisted tradespeople in the past. This will highlight your ability to fit into their team and contribute positively.
